WebHowever, the early 9N had 32" rear rims as opposed to the more common 28's. Also, a lot of the 9N tranmissions had straight cut INPUT gears. Most of the 2Ns had helical cut input gears with straight cut transmission gears. You need the helical input gear to use a sherman FYI. Most 9N's (not all) had smooth cast rear hubs with no rivets. WebSep 7, 2024 · The most glaring difference is the engine. Ford-Ferguson used a flathead and after the split Ferguson adopted an OHV design. Ford stayed with the flathead up until the introduction of the NAA in 1953. TOH. Correction - TO20 production began in 1948 in Dearborn, MI. TOH.

WebOct 20, 2008 · Only major differences are a couple horsepower, 8n has 4 speed trans and 9n has 3 speed trans. 8n is newer than the 9n and has more hp. Newer 8n have side distributor older 8n's and 9n's had front distributor. Neither has live PTO which if you are looking to run a bush hog or tiller I would highly reccommend. .

Ford tractors changed dramatically in 1939 when over 10,000 9N tractors were sold in the first year of production. The model, 9, 2, then 8 reflect the year that model came out in the show rooms ... 1939 for the 9N, 1942 for the 2N, and 1948 for the 8N.
